    This is a small shop but chock full of good things, almost all made in Nebraska. The socks are designed in Nebraska, but made somewhere else. This is the perfect place to buy unique gifts and support small businesses and makers in our state. I have sent gifts from here to remind my son in Australia about his roots and other gifts to folks out of state. There are t-shirts, soaps, candles, delicious candies, bath products, mugs, and foods such as jams, jellies, and salsas. There's lots of other stuff here too. So if you're looking for a gift for the person who has everything, you just might find the perfect thing here.

    Made in Omaha is a gift/store front for local makers of Omaha and greater Nebraska. For many budding local artisans, having a store front is tough to afford, and maintain. Made in Omaha gives small businesses a chance to showcase their goods and works in the form of a storefront with a very obvious and easy to understand name and concept. Examples of things here include: candles, artwork, jewelry, clothing, home decor. Stop by and shop local!

    We explored a few Omaha stops from the Nebraska Passport which brought us to the door stop of Made in Omaha. We visited the shop in Countryside Village off of 81st & Pacific Streets but learned they have opened another store front in the Old Market area. If you are looking for an Omaha or Nebraska themed gift or accessory this is your one stop store to purchase framed and unframed prints of various neighborhoods including: Memorial Park, Benson, Hanscom Park, and the Old Market. Many other unique Omaha and Nebraska themed prints, t shirts, socks and hats were available as well as soaps, candles and packaged food items. Putting together a Nebraska gift basket would be a snap. My understanding is that everything in the store is from local makers. I purchased men's socks with Omaha street signs and wished I would have purchased a black and white print with Omaha landmarks............ that may be my excuse for coming back to Made in Omaha with a full wallet :) Parking at the door, easy access off Pacific Street, and friendly efficient service are all pluses for this shopper.
